Subject: make uninstall fails in rmdir
Date: Thu, 30 Mar 2017 21:22:28 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170330192228.GA89598@www.stare.cz> (raw)

Hi Ingo,

this is 1.14.1 on a MacOSX 10.6.8

mandoc itself seems to work just fine,
but 'make uninstall' fails with the

	rmdir $(DESTDIR)$(INCLUDEDIR)

as the directory was not created with 'make install',
because I have not installed the library (right?).

It's actually the last command of the uninstall target
so the failure does not stop anything else from happening,
but it still leaves the user wondering if something
was left behind (non-unistalled) when 'make uninstall' failed.
